HADS separates anxiety and depression into two subscales, making it useful for people who want a concise view of worry, tension, low mood, and loss of interest.
The scale avoids heavy reliance on sleep, appetite, or illness-related symptoms, so it is often used in hospital, health-check, and general screening contexts.
A high score is not a diagnosis. If symptoms are persistent or affecting daily life, work, sleep, or relationships, discuss the result with a qualified professional.
